利用Robot Framework进行PC端自动化测试
发布时间: 2023-12-19 20:21:41 阅读量: 42 订阅数: 46
# 第一章:Robot Framework简介
Robot Framework是一个通用的自动化测试框架。它采用关键字驱动的方式编写测试用例,支持可扩展的自定义关键字库,并提供丰富的库和工具来简化测试案例的编写、执行和报告。Robot Framework既可以用于功能测试,也可以用于自动化测试和持续集成。它支持多种接口测试类型,包括Web,API,移动端和桌面应用等。
## 1.1 什么是Robot Framework
Robot Framework是一个通用的自动化测试框架,使用Python编写,基于关键字驱动的测试方法。它的测试用例可以使用关键字来描述,这些关键字可以是自定义的也可以是现有的库中提供的。
## 1.2 Robot Framework的优势
- 易读易写:Robot Framework使用关键字驱动,测试用例的编写非常直观,易于理解和维护。
- 可扩展性强:Robot Framework支持丰富的库,也支持自定义关键字库,可以方便地扩展测试用例的功能。
- 广泛应用:Robot Framework可以用于Web、API、移动端和桌面应用等多种测试类型,同时也支持不同的操作系统和浏览器。
## 1.3 Robot Framework的安装与配置
要使用Robot Framework,首先需要安装Python,然后使用Python的包管理工具pip来安装Robot Framework。安装完成后,还需要配置一些环境变量和相关的依赖库。
## 第二章:PC端自动化测试概述
自动化测试在PC端应用中具有重要意义,本章将介绍PC端自动化测试的重要性、应用场景以及工具的选择。
### 3. 第三章:为PC端自动化测试准备环境
PC端自动化测试的成功与否很大程度上取决于环境的准备,包括硬件条件、软件环境和测试数据的准备。在本章中,我们将详细讨论如何为PC端自动化测试准备环境。
#### 3.1 准备PC端自动化测试的硬件条件
PC端自动化测试需要保证硬件条件稳定可靠,包括但不限于:
- 笔记本电脑或台式机:用于运行自动化测试用例的PC设备。
- 外部设备:可能需要连接外部设备进行测试,如打印机、扫描仪等。
- 网络环境:确保网络畅通,特别是对于需要网络连接的应用程序测试。
#### 3.2 搭建PC端自动化测试的软件环境
在选择合适的自动化测试工具后,需要在PC端搭建相应的软件环境,包括:
- 操作系统:确保PC端安装了适合的操作系统,如Windows、MacOS、Linux等。
- 浏览器与应用程序:根据测试需求安装相应的浏览器版本以及待测试的应用程序。
- 自动化测试工具:安装并配置选定的自动化测试工具,如Robot Framework、Selenium等。
####
0
0